编程驱动术语是什么意思
-
编程驱动术语是指在编程过程中使用的一些特定的术语或概念,用来描述和解释代码的执行过程、数据的流动以及程序的行为。这些术语和概念有助于程序员理解和思考问题,设计和实现高效、可靠的软件系统。以下是一些常见的编程驱动术语的解释:
-
变量:在编程中,变量用来存储数据。它们有不同的类型,如整数、字符、字符串等。程序可以通过改变变量的值来控制其行为和输出。
-
函数:函数是一段可重用的代码块,用来执行特定的任务。它接收输入参数,并可能返回结果。函数封装了特定的功能,可以在程序中多次调用。
-
控制流:控制流是代码执行的顺序和条件。常见的控制流语句包括条件语句(如if-else语句)和循环语句(如for循环和while循环),它们根据条件来决定执行代码的路径。
-
数据结构:数据结构是一种组织和存储数据的方式。常见的数据结构有数组、链表、堆栈、队列、树和图等。选择合适的数据结构可以提高程序的效率和性能。
-
算法:算法是解决特定问题的一系列步骤。它们描述了实现某个功能或完成某个任务的详细方法。编程中常用的算法包括排序、搜索、图算法等。
-
模块:模块是将程序分割成独立的功能单元。每个模块负责特定的任务,可以通过调用其他模块来共同完成复杂的功能。模块化编程有助于提高代码的可读性和维护性。
-
异常处理:异常处理用于处理程序在执行过程中发生的错误或异常情况。它可以捕获异常并采取相应的措施,如输出错误消息、恢复程序运行或终止程序。
总之,编程驱动术语是指在编程中常用的一些术语或概念,用来描述代码的执行过程、数据的流动和程序的行为。程序员需要理解和应用这些术语,以实现高效、可靠的软件系统。
1年前 -
-
编程驱动术语是指一种编程方法论,通过将问题分解为小的可处理的任务,并按照一定的顺序来组织和执行这些任务。在编程驱动中,重点是问题的解决方法和具体的步骤,而不是仅仅关注最终的结果。编程驱动的目标是通过逐步实现每个任务来设计和构建整个程序。
以下是编程驱动术语的一些关键概念和方法:
1.测试驱动开发(TDD):测试驱动开发是一种编程方法,其中测试用例在编写代码之前被创建并在代码编写过程中持续运行。 TDD的目标是通过测试来驱动代码的设计和实现,以确保代码在满足特定需求的同时具有良好的功能和鲁棒性。
2.行为驱动开发(BDD):行为驱动开发是一种关注系统行为和用户需求的编程方法。在BDD中,通过使用自然语言来描述系统的行为和期望结果,从而定义测试用例。这种方法鼓励在测试中使用用户故事和场景来描述预期的行为,以便更好地理解和交流系统需求。
3.迭代开发:迭代开发是一种采用反复迭代和增量开发的软件开发方法。在迭代开发中,需求和功能通过一系列的迭代周期进行开发和测试,每个迭代周期都会交付可运行的软件。这种方法允许开发人员和用户在项目的不同阶段进行反馈和调整,从而更好地满足系统需求。
4.持续集成(CI):持续集成是一种通过频繁集成和测试代码的开发方法。在CI中,开发者将代码频繁地自动集成到主干代码库中,并立即进行自动化测试和构建。这种方法有助于尽早发现和解决代码错误,提高开发效率和质量。
5.敏捷开发方法:敏捷开发是一种强调快速迭代和合作开发的软件开发方法。在敏捷开发中,开发团队通过合作、适应和迭代的方式来开发软件。这种方法注重团队成员之间的交流和协作,以及对需求的灵活性和响应能力。
总之,编程驱动术语是一种关注问题解决方法和步骤的编程方法论,通过测试驱动开发、行为驱动开发、迭代开发、持续集成和敏捷开发等方法来提高软件开发过程中的效率和质量。
1年前 -
编程驱动术语是指通过编程语言和代码来实现特定功能或目标的一种方法或方式。它强调通过编写代码来驱动和实现某些任务或业务逻辑,以达到预期的结果。
编程驱动是一种常见的软件开发方法,它在许多不同领域和应用中都有广泛的应用。它使用编程语言和相关的工具和技术来自动化和简化日常任务,并提高生产力和效率。
在编程驱动的方法中,开发者首先确定要实现的目标或任务,然后使用所选的编程语言编写相应的代码来执行这些任务。这些代码会告诉计算机如何处理输入数据,并生成期望的输出结果。开发者通过定义和实现必要的算法、数据结构和函数来构建整个程序。
编程驱动术语还涉及使用测试驱动开发(TDD)的原则,其中开发者首先编写测试用例来定义所需的功能和功能,然后编写代码来满足测试用例。这种方法可以提高代码的质量和稳定性,并确保所开发的程序具有预期的功能和行为。
在编程驱动的过程中,开发者通常会使用集成开发环境(IDE)等开发工具来编写、调试和测试代码。他们还可能使用版本控制系统来跟踪和管理代码的变更。
总而言之,编程驱动术语是一种基于编程语言和代码编写的方法,目的是实现特定功能或任务,并提高生产效率和质量。它强调通过编写代码来驱动和实现程序逻辑,以达到预期的结果。
1年前